AMAKHOSi - The Kings of Africa
brings the vibrant culture of South Africa to the Big Top in
an extravagant show that incorporates infectious music and pounding
rhythms, gravity-defying acrobatics and deft choreography, and
elaborate sets and costumes!
The ancient and diverse African culture is a rich
source of inspiration for AMAKHOSi
which features an international cast of 40 and combines time-honoured
traditions with modern life to create a vividly imagined, wildly
energetic and exhilarating spectacle.
AMAKHOSi - The Kings of Africa
tells the story of a cruel witch queen who ruled a mighty mountain.
She had a daughter Nsephe who, while looking into water, fell
in love with the reflection of the handsome Prince Ziko. The
princess enlisted the help of two warrior brothers to search
for Ziko which enraged the witch queen. Once the brothers embarked
on their journey, the evil queen caged her daughter at the top
of the mountain. The warrior brothers found Ziko, and they all
returned to rescue Nsephe from the mountaintop. A great battle
between the Princess' and the witch queen's army ensued, causing
the mountain to go flat. Prince Ziko trapped the witch queen
in a cave inside the mountain, and he and Nsephe ruled as king
and queen of mountain Amakhosi!
